Abilene is 0-3 against Duncanville since January of 2021 but things could change on Saturday. The Eagles will take on the Panthers and Pantherettes in a tournament on Saturday. Neither squad made it on the board the last time they hit the pitch, so they've probably got a bit of extra motivation.
Friday just wasn't the day for Abilene's offense. They fell just short of Southlake Carroll by a score of 1-0 on Friday.
Meanwhile, Duncanville managed to keep up with Keller until halftime on Friday, but things quickly went downhill from there. The Panthers and Pantherettes came up short against the Indians, falling 4-1.
Duncanville's goal came courtesy of Nathan Mendez, who's now up to three this season.
Duncanville's loss dropped their record down to 2-5. As for Abilene, their defeat dropped their record down to 5-2.
